Heavy-Duty Heat Shield Tape

This heavy-duty heat shield tape works wonders in reflecting radiant heat. With a capacity to reflect over 90% of radiant heat (ASTM F1939 & Mil-C-24929A) in certain conditions this rugged tape was meant to last. With a full fiberglass backing it can survive the rigors of in the field or on the job requirements. Thermaflect™ Tape withstand 1100°F continuous radiant heat (requires minimum of 1” of airspace) and 500°F of direct contact.
